Oral
Species
Dog
Composition / specifications
Each chewable tablet contains 1.25, 2.5, 5, or 10 milligrams (mg) pimobendan.

Dogs

Indication

Vetmedin® is indicated for the delay of onset of congestive heart failure in dogs with Stage B2 preclinical myxomatous mitral valve disease. Stage B2 preclinical myxomatous mitral valve disease (MMVD) refers to dogs with asymptomatic MMVD that have a moderate or loud mitral murmur due to mitral regurgitation and cardiomegaly.
For the management of the signs of mild, moderate, or severe congestive heart failure in dogs due to clinical MMVD or dilated cardiomyopathy (DCM); for use with concurrent therapy for congestive heart failure (e.g., furosemide, etc.) as appropriate on a case-by-case basis.

Dosage

Administer orally at a total daily dose of 0.23 mg/lb. (0.5 mg/kg) body weight, using a suitable combination of whole or half tablets. The total daily dose should be divided into 2 portions that are not necessarily equal, and the portions should be administered approximately 12 hours apart (i.e., morning and evening). The tablets are scored, and the calculated dosage should be provided to the nearest half tablet increment.

Oral
Species
Dog
Composition / specifications
1.5 mg/mL

Dogs

Indication

For the delay of onset of congestive heart failure (CHF) in dogs with Stage B2 preclinical myxomatous mitral valve disease (MMVD). Stage B2 preclinical MMVD refers to dogs with asymptomatic MMVD that have a moderate or loud mitral murmur due to mitral regurgitation and cardiomegaly.
For the management of the signs of mild, moderate, or severe CHF in dogs due to clinical MMVD or dilated cardiomyopathy (DCM). For use with concurrent therapy for CHF (e.g., furosemide, etc.) as appropriate on a case-by-case basis.

Dosage

Administer orally at a total daily dose of 0.23 mg/lb (0.5 mg/kg) body weight. The total daily dose should be divided into 2 equal portions administered approximately 12 hours apart (i.e., morning and evening).

Overdose Information

Overdose may lead to severe tachycardia, hypotension, arrhythmias, or collapse. Supportive and critical care is recommended.
